Tilt window installation involves replacing existing windows with tilt-in models that open inward from the top or side. This type of window design allows for easier cleaning and maintenance, as homeowners can access both sides of the glass from inside the property. Professional service providers handle the entire process, including removing the old windows, preparing the opening, and securely installing the new tilt windows to ensure proper operation and energy efficiency.

This service can help address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and poor insulation. Tilt windows often provide better sealing against outdoor elements, which can lead to reduced energy bills and increased comfort inside the home. They are also a practical choice for properties where easy access for cleaning or ventilation is a priority, making them a popular upgrade for homeowners looking to improve their living environment.

The overview below groups typical Tilt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Smith, AR.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tilt window repairs or replacements us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and type.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of the spectrum.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ing an entire tilt window often costs between $600 and $1,200 per unit. Local contractors in Fort Smith commonly see projects in this range for standard-sized windows with basic features. Larger or more customized windows can cost more.

Multiple Window Installations - When installing several tilt windows at once, costs typically range from $2,000 to $5,000 for a standard home. Many projects in this category fall in the middle, with larger, more complex projects reaching higher totals.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more complex tilt window installations, such as for commercial buildings or custom designs,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and often involve specialized materials or features, increasing over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are tilt windows? Tilt windows are a type of window that can be tilted inward for easy cleaning and maintenance, offering convenience and improved ventilation.

What types of homes are suitable for tilt window installation? Tilt windows can be installed in a variety of residential settings, including single-family homes, apartments, and condominiums, depending on the existing window framework.

How do local contractors handle tilt window installation? Local service providers typically assess the existing window openings, recommend suitable tilt window styles, and perform professional installation to ensure proper operation and durability.

Are there different styles of tilt windows available? Yes, tilt windows come in various styles such as double-hung, casement, and sliding, allowing homeowners to choose options that match their aesthetic and functional preferences.
